算法笔记 26040 Problem B 习题6-5 数组元素逆置

孤街浪徒 提交于 2020-01-07 02:03:35

问题 B: 习题6-5 数组元素逆置

时间限制: 1 Sec 内存限制: 12 MB

题目描述
将一个长度为10的整型数组中的值按逆序重新存放。
如:原来的顺序为1,2,3,4,5,6,7,8,9,0,要求改为0,9,8,7,6,5,4,3,2,1

输入
从键盘上输入以空格分隔的10个整数。

输出
按相反的顺序输出这10个数,每个数占一行。

样例输入
1 2 3 4 5 6 7 8 9 0

样例输出
0
9
8
7
6
5
4
3
2
1

#include <stdio.h>
int main() {
	int a[10];
	int n,i,t;
	for (i=0;i<10;i++) {
		scanf("%d ",&a[i]);
	}

	for (n=0;n<9;n++) {
		for (i=9;i>n;i--) {
			t=a[i];
			a[i]=a[i-1];
			a[i-1]=t;
		}
	}

	for (i=0;i<10;i++) {
		printf("%d\n",a[i]);
	}

	return 0;
}
标签
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!